What Is Answer Engine Optimization (AEO)?

Answer engine optimization (AEO) is the practice of structuring content so that a direct answer to a specific question can be extracted cleanly — by search features such as featured snippets, or by assistants that reply in prose instead of links.

Why it matters

Questions are how most people phrase searches, and the pages that win answer slots are usually the ones that answer in the first two sentences rather than after six hundred words of preamble. That discipline also serves the readers who only skim.

Example

A page on link attributes opens with a two-sentence answer to "what does rel=sponsored mean", then expands underneath. The short answer is what a snippet or an assistant can lift whole.

Common misconception

That marking a page up or bolting on an FAQ block wins the answer slot. Schema helps machines parse a page; it does not promise selection. Google and the assistant vendors pick sources on their own criteria and revise them constantly, so no format guarantees you the answer.
